When working with a laboratory microscope, one important consideration is the type of glassware that complements the microscope itself. Essential glassware includes slides, cover slips, and specimen containers. Each piece serves a specific purpose; for instance, slides are used to hold samples for examination under the microscope, while cover slips protect the specimens and enhance the quality of the viewed image.

Moreover, it's crucial to select glassware that is compatible with the microscope's optical features. For example, the refractive index of the glass used in slides must be suitable for optimal light transmission. Each laboratory may require different types of glassware and equipment based on the studies they conduct. For instance, microbiology labs may need specialized petri dishes, while histology labs require specific mounting media and tissue processing apparatus. Understanding the specific needs of your laboratory will aid in selecting the appropriate laboratory microscope glassware equipment.

The technical specifications of laboratory microscope glassware equipment include dimensions, material types, and compatibility with various microscopes. Common materials for microscope slides include borosilicate glass, which offers durability and resistance to thermal shock. The thickness of slides is typically standardized at 1mm, but there are variations depending on specific laboratory needs.
